#07063b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#07063b is composed of 2.7% red, 2.4% green and 23.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.1% cyan, 89.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 76.9% black. It has a hue angle of 241.1 degrees, a saturation of 81.5% and a lightness of 12.7%. #07063b color hex could be obtained by blending #0e0c76 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

● #07063b color description : Very dark blue.
#07063b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#07063b has RGB values of R:7, G:6, B:59 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.77. Its decimal value is 460347.
